    In 10.1.2, we have intentionally removed the option 'Print color as Black' from the print dialog due to its incorrect behaviour of converting all text to black. The correct one is to print it as Grayscale and for doing so, you can follow the two below mentioned methods:
    Method 1:
    1. Select your printer and click on its properties button.
    2. Search for option 'Print in Grayscale', which is provided at different location for different printers. One I am attaching for reference is under 'Color' tab of printer properties
    3. Click ok and then print.
    Method 2:
    1. Select your printer.
    2. click on Advance button.
    3.Select Color management section -> 'Working Gray' as color profile.
    4. click ok and then print.

    I went to the link suggested and the answer was what I already knew. Shame on HP for selling a product without including that you need all cartridges full to use black and white In LARGE BOLD  print. The following is not helpful.  It only tells me what I already know.   I will NEVER buy an HP product again. HP Officejet Printers - Printing with Depleted CartridgesIssueCan the printer operate for an extended period of time with depleted cartridges?SolutionFor regular usage, this product is not designed to print using only the black cartridge when the color cartridges are out of ink.However, your printer is designed to let you print as long as possible when your cartridges start to run out of ink. When there is sufficient ink in the printhead, the printer will offer you the use of black ink only when one or more of the color cartridges are out of ink, and the use of color ink only when the black cartridge is out of ink.The amount that you can print using black or color ink only is limited, so have replacement ink cartridges available when you are printing with black or color ink only.When there is no longer sufficient ink to print you will get a message that one or more cartridges are depleted, and you will need to replace the depleted cartridges before you resume printing.

    Hi,
    Follow the steps below in order to print using Black Ink only:
    1. From the application used to print, click the File menu and select Print.
    The Print window appears.
    NOTE: The Print window might be minimized - Click the Show Details button to see all available settings.
    2. To access the color options, click the lowest selection box listed as the name of the program (e.g. TextEdit)
    Will appear as Copies & Pages within Microsoft Office applications.
    3. Select Paper Type/Quality from the drop-down menu.
    4. Click the triangle next to Color Options to expend the settings.
    5. Set the Color field as Grayscale.
    6. Set the Grayscale Mode as Black Ink Cartridge Only.
    You may save the settings for future use by clicking Presets > Save Current Settings as Preset...
    A used preset will remain as default till another preset will be used.
